WARNING: There is a mention of suicide, PTSD, death, drowning in this episode.
The most profound concept around grief and loss is that we do do it even though it feels impossible and it is actually impossible.
As a grief and loss specialist Meghan Riordan Jarvis, didn’t expect how unprepared she was after her mother’s death. Grief-stricken, she found herself unable to go on with life and ended up in the same inpatient cliinic where she used to send her clients.
What makes grief traumatic? The symptoms of grief, and so much more.
